Landscaping in Southampton — what to know
Site & seasonal factors
Landscaping isn't a Mass Save program, but Southampton's river and valley soils drive the work. The Manhan River, several brooks, and surrounding wetlands fall under the Conservation Commission's enforcement of the Wetlands Protection Act across the 100-foot wetland buffer and the 200-foot Riverfront Area. Grading, walls, and plantings inside those zones need an Order of Conditions.
The Pioneer Valley soils here are good — productive loams on the lower ground, supporting farms and serious home gardens, with rockier till on the uplands toward the hills. Deer and tick pressure are heavy across the wooded lots, the latter because the valley sits in a heavy Lyme corridor.
Permits in Southampton
Southampton's Conservation Commission reviews grading, retaining walls, drainage, and plantings within the 100-foot wetland buffer or the 200-foot Manhan River Riverfront Area, issuing an Order of Conditions under the Wetlands Protection Act. The Building Department typically requires a permit for retaining walls over four feet of exposed height, with engineered designs for taller walls. Pools need building and electrical permits with fencing. Stormwater and erosion controls are commonly conditioned on grading near the river and brooks.
Typical project cost
Southampton pricing runs below eastern MA, reflecting Pioneer Valley rates. Weekly mowing runs $40-60, spring cleanup $250-550, fall cleanup $300-700, and bark mulch $70-105 per yard installed. A six-zone irrigation system runs $4,500-7,000. Paver patios start around $7K; bluestone runs $9-14K. Drainage fixes around a wet lot commonly run $3-12K. Full design-build projects typically land in the $20-55K range when homeowners take on a complete yard with patio, plantings, and drainage.
About Southampton homes
Southampton sits in the Pioneer Valley foothills of Hampshire County, with about 6,185 residents and 2,587 housing units. The median home is roughly 47 years old, a mix of older village and farm homes plus newer subdivisions on lots between Easthampton and Westfield.
This is a semi-rural valley-edge town with working farms, woods, and the Manhan River winding through it. Landscaping here serves a value-conscious mix of suburban and rural lots, with lawn care, drainage, and modest hardscape leading the demand.
Common questions — Landscaping in Southampton
- Is my Southampton lot near the Manhan River buffer?
- Possibly. The Manhan River carries 200-foot Riverfront Area protection, and mapped wetlands add a 100-foot buffer. The Conservation Commission reviews grading and hardscape inside those zones, so check the town wetland mapping for your parcel before planning work.
- Are Southampton's valley soils good for a garden?
- Yes — the lower-ground loams are productive and support farms and large home gardens with normal amendment. Upland till lots toward the hills are rockier and benefit from added compost. The main limit on either is deer browse, not soil.
- How bad are ticks in Southampton?
- Significant — the Pioneer Valley is in a heavy Lyme corridor. Mowed buffers between lawn and woods, mulch barriers, and keeping grass short reduce exposure, and some homeowners use targeted perimeter treatment while others prefer non-chemical management.
- Do I need a permit for a retaining wall in Southampton?
- The Building Department generally requires a permit for walls over four feet of exposed height, with engineered designs for taller walls. Walls within a wetland or river buffer also need Conservation Commission approval.
- What's the best-value upgrade for a Southampton yard?
- Fix drainage first, renovate the lawn with proper soil prep, and add defined mulch beds with tough, deer-resistant shrubs. Irrigation and hardscape can follow. Local crews keep rates well below the Boston-area market.
